This PR fixes the Quillbatch PDF invoice renderer truncating long line items at page breaks. Rendering now pre-measures row heights and paginates before layout. If memory alerts fire overnight, the renderer pool is the likely culprit; restart is safe and idempotent. The relevant tuning constants are listed below:

constants for bawif-kawif:
QUOTAS = {
    "ulaael": 5,
    "holael": 10,
}

Alert: Gridleaf Export Memory Pressure

This alert fires when the Gridleaf spreadsheet export workers exceed 80% of their memory allocation for more than five minutes. The usual cause is a tenant exporting a sheet with heavy formula chains, which balloons the in-memory cell graph. First response: check the export queue for jobs over 200k rows and pause them; the worker will recover on its own. Do not restart the pod mid-export, as partial files confuse the retry logic. Full runbook steps and past occurrences are on the internal page.

dashboard of yahaf-kajep = https://jira.zemvarsys.internal/display/projects/browse/browse/a08b

Handover — Calvex Line Pricing

Current state: Calvex mid-tier priced 8% under the Norvale benchmark. Holding until Q2. Discount authority capped at 5% for regional teams; exceptions go through Finance. Pending: repricing of the Calvex Pro tier after the Denmoor cost review lands. Don't touch bundle pricing — contractual constraints with two distributors. Margin tracker updated weekly; check it before approving anything. Open question: whether to sunset the entry SKU. Direction on that is in the note below.

internal memo for hahif-hahaf: Headcount on the Zorwyn team goes from 9 to 100 by the end of October. Gross margin on Zorwyn came in at 5 percent against a plan of 10 percent.

Handover: Queuemill replacement. We're killing the homegrown job queue in Brackwood's billing service. New contractor: migrate workers to Ferrobus, topic names stay the same. Dead-letter handling is in `retry_sink.py`; don't touch scheduling cron until cutover. Old queue stays read-only for two weeks. Ping Dalia Renn if consumers stall. To unlock the legacy admin vault, use the passphrase below.

unlock words, fafop-hawep: briwyn-oliix-sorox